--- gilbert menezes <[EMAIL PROTECTED]> wrote: > btw,What *technical* function did you perform for > the Brazilian Navy?
Procured spares for engines and allied equipment for Niteroi-class frigates, Humait�-class subs, Sea-king and Lynx helicopters, IFF equipment etc. in the European market, and purchased repair and maintenance manuals for the foregoing. My technical knowledge came into the fore in translating Portuguese technical requirements into English technical terms, when suitable substitutes were required to be procured for obsoleted electronic spares, and to handle telex machines in a couple of emergencies when no telex operator had turned up for work (there were no fax machines in popular use until the late 1980s). Next I moved into the field of software development, developing an on-line purchasing system and an on-line accounting system to be compatible with the Brazilian federal SIAFI system on mini-computers, and before I left, set up a Netware LAN. > How many times did you step on the deck of the > carrier *Minas Gerais*?
